What is a Water Damage Restoration Invoice?

A water damage restoration invoice is a formal document that serves as a request for payment from service providers to clients after restoration work. Its primary function is to detail the services rendered, costs incurred, and payment terms. These invoices are critical in the restoration industry, as they ensure transparency in transactions and help maintain professionalism and trust between parties. Invoicing accurately is essential for fostering lasting business relationships.

Purpose and Benefits of the Water Damage Restoration Invoice

The water damage restoration invoice plays a vital role in facilitating transactions between service providers and clients. It ensures that clients receive a detailed breakdown of the services performed, which enhances clarity and understanding of the charges. Additionally, proper documentation through these invoices can significantly aid clients in filing insurance claims and managing their financial records effectively.

The water damage restoration invoice can be used by service providers who have completed water damage restoration for clients, including businesses, contractors, and freelancers in the restoration field.
While there are generally no strict deadlines for submitting invoices, it’s advisable to send them as soon as the service is completed to ensure prompt payment and facilitate any insurance claims.
You can submit the invoice via email directly from pdfFiller, download it as a PDF to send through your own email, or upload it to an online portal if required by your client.
Supporting documents could include before-and-after photos of the damaged areas, a detailed breakdown of services rendered, and any relevant estimates or agreements signed by the client.
It's important to avoid common mistakes such as missing out client information, not including service details, or inaccuracies in pricing. Double-checking for completeness can help prevent errors.
Processing times can vary greatly depending on the client's policies. Typically, payments are processed within 30 days, but it could take longer if sent through insurance claims.
